This is the second prototype of AKES’s upcoming “Cruel Angel.” A brief reminder of what this is: it’s the first standalone aircraft project from Atomic Klounada Experimental Systems – a mid-sized, generation 5- multirole fighter developed as part of a challenge by Ktoto14. This time its positioning is a bit different: it’s intended to compete with the F-35A and to fill the niche between Banana Aerospace Industries’ planes – the light XF-1 and F-1000 and the monstrous FB-2, which weighs over 40 tonnes. Compared to the “Lightning II,” I think it will win on speed and maneuverability, but lose somewhat on range (it carries almost a ton less fuel, apparently), stealth, and internal weapons-bay volume, compensating with a larger number of external hardpoints. Oh, and it doesn’t have an internal cannon.
